Output 529718e6f34699ef68e86724f02a5c1d40d57bfc93309909fab3785b7edb3a6c:1

value
7562708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0b0782735845c71c6cbddc4a8d66c81d17df29 OP_EQUAL
address
3Ee567dxuKb3Wbz9iEsCSYN3L5imc26Uhu
transaction
529718e6f34699ef68e86724f02a5c1d40d57bfc93309909fab3785b7edb3a6c
confirmations
284476
spent
true